Tracing the Roots of House

Born in the vibrant clubs of Chicago during the early, house music quickly became. Its infectious rhythms and soulful vocals provided a soundtrack for a generation yearning for something new. DJs like Marshall Jefferson were the pioneers, blending disco, funk, and soul into a sound that was both revolutionary.

Within its grassroots beginnings, house music spread like wildfire, transforming dance floors across the globe. Offshoots emerged, each with their own unique character, from the techy sounds of Detroit to the upbeat rhythms of New York.

From Chicago to the World: The Global Sound of House

Born from the vibrant underground scene of 1980s Chicago, house music quickly spread the world. Driven by a pulsing beat, soulful vocals, and an infectious feel, it resonated universally with dancers.

From its origins in Chicago, house music transformed into a global movement. The genre has shaped countless other genres, blending with elements of techno to create new and exciting sounds.
